Output 585bf8c99bbf85d62c3c68b0400cc5ef7d8a0a8a7a5b5a776d14916d15dfa01d:1

value
2857569
script pubkey
OP_0 OP_PUSHBYTES_20 f3c8f17593c6ea7975a5710f11b1606fdc590f13
address
ltc1q70y0zavncm48jad9wy83rvtqdlw9jrcnzlclrs
transaction
585bf8c99bbf85d62c3c68b0400cc5ef7d8a0a8a7a5b5a776d14916d15dfa01d
spent
true